#704b87 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#704b87 is composed of 43.9% red, 29.4% green and 52.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17% cyan, 44.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 277 degrees, a saturation of 28.6% and a lightness of 41.2%. #704b87 color hex could be obtained by blending #e096ff with #00000f.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

Shades and Tints of #704b87

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070509 is the darkest color, while #fcfb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#704b87

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a636f is the less saturated color, while #8102d0 is the most saturated one.
